About Eveline Wuttke

Eveline Wuttke is a scholar working on Human Factors and Ergonomics, Education and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management, having authored 46 papers that have together received 350 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Education Methods and Technologies (21 papers), Vocational Education and Training (17 papers) and Sociology and Education Studies (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Accounting (98 citations), Human Factors and Ergonomics (16 citations) and Education (181 citations). Eveline Wuttke has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Austria and United States. Frequent co-authors include Jürgen Seifried, Carmela Aprea, Andreas Rausch, Klaus Breuer, Peter Davies, Jane S. Lopus, Bernhard Schmitz, Thomas Rosemann, Karsten D. Wolf and Marc Egloffstein. Their work appears in journals such as Frontiers in Psychology, Peabody Journal of Education and Zeitschrift für Psychologie.
